Description

--vex is currently available only in SBOM scanning (trivy sbom). #5439 has changed to always generate PURLs, except when generating SBOMs. It is easy to extend VEX support to other targets like container images.

Example

$ trivy image debian:11 --vex debian11.vex.csaf
